Shane Warne has stepped up to defend his parenting in the wake of revelations about son Jackson’s bizarre diet.

The youngest recruit on SAS Australia shocked viewers when he admitted to having only eaten about 10 different foods in his life.
The younger Warne, 21, earned the nickname soup boy when he revealed he had never tried tomato soup.
On Friday, his cricket legend father said he had tried to entice Jackson to try a greater variety of foods without luck.
